the other day I was playing a game Jamming Barrier was the objective.

I had 2 GR75s flying towards an ISD. My opponent was lining up his ISD to take them out. The ISD just activated it was Medium range of 1 of my GR75 but it was behind the dust field and could not be shoot at so it just moved forwards. After my GR75 next activation it would cross the Dust Field and be close Range of the ISD and s*** out of luck. and my other would drop the round after. But there was just enough luck left as 1 of the 3 Y Wing it was pushing landed a crit and I had the man him self Dodanna and wouldn't you know it one of the crits I had to pick from was Blinded Gunner. My opponent didn't mind to much as he let slip he had a repair command next. He had a smile on his face knowing that both my GR75s would soon drop. Then I moved my GR75 and taped Slicer Tools and flipped his Repair to a Squadron command. Both my GR75s lived and the ISD went down in flames from my Bombers and AF fire. If he had of taken out my GR75s my other 2 ships with 1-2 hit points left would have dropped and he would have won the game. In the end I only lost 1 squadron

It felt so dirty doing that to my opponent and it was only his second game but some times things just work your way

The Enemy can use it when they are spending Defense Tokens

It resolves immediately, as long as the Defending Ship is at Close Range to the Attacker, and the Interdictor is at Distance 1-3 of the Defender (or is the Defender)...

You Roll your Attack Dice.

You Modify Your Attack Dice (Including Spending ACC results to lock down defense tokens)

The Enemy Spends Defense Tokens & Targeting Scrambler. The Targeting Scrambler resolves immediately, just like an Evade Token.

Any Rerolls that result in ACC results are (essentially, in a non-SW7 World) Rendered useless, as you are past the point where you may Spend them to lock down Tokens.

Then move on to the damage steps, as per usual.

(Resolve Critical, tally Damage, apply damage 1 point at a time).

Ackbar Defiance MC80 with Enhanced Armament and a CF command dialed in. Ten dice coming at my Demo, and eight of them showing double hits, hits, or crits, for a total of twelve damage. My opponent is, to put it politely, rather jubilant...

I declare Targeting Scramblers on four of the red dice, and Every. Last. One. turns up blank. I brace the remaining four damage down to two, and redirect that to the side shield.

My opponent is, to continue to put it politely, rather less than jubilant.

He makes to move his ship, having no further targets. I use G-8 Projectors to drop him to speed 0, which leaves him tee-d up for the Demo next turn.

My opponent is now, it seems, quietly consulting an imaginary friend - or perhaps a spirit guide - on where I can stick my ship.

I activate my 'dictor, and use Projection Experts to restore the two missing shields from the Demo.

My opponent, at this stage, has decided to demonstrate how many colours of purple and red his face can turn. His language was equally colourful, albeit much more blue.

Hi, I'm Dex, and I enjoy control play.
